REX American Resources (NYSE:REX) Stock Rating Upgraded by Wall Street Zen

REX American Resources (NYSE:REXGet Free Report) was upgraded by equities researchers at Wall Street Zen from a “hold” rating to a “buy” rating in a research report issued to clients and investors on Saturday.

Separately, Weiss Ratings reiterated a “hold (c+)” rating on shares of REX American Resources in a report on Wednesday, October 8th. One research analyst has rated the stock with a Buy rating and one has issued a Hold r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at, REX American Resources has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us price target of $25.00.

REX American Resources Stock Down 3.9%

Shares of NYSE REX opened at $33.69 on Friday. The business’s 50 day moving average price is $32.20 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$28.51. The company has a market cap of $1.11 billion, a PE ratio of 22.54 and a beta of 0.73. REX American Resources has a twelve month low of $16.73 and a twelve month high of $36.50.

REX American Resources (NYSE:REXG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, December 4th. The energy company reported $0.71 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.26 by $0.45. The company had revenue of $175.63 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$169.00 million. REX American Resources had a return on equity of 7.89% and a net margin of 7.73%.During the same period last year, the firm posted $1.38 earnings per share. As a group, research analysts anticipate that REX American Resources will post 2.93 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About REX American Resources

REX American Resources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, produces and sells ethanol in the United States. The company also offers corn, distillers grains, ethanol, distillers corn oil, gasoline, and natural gas. In addition, it provides dry distillers grains with solubles, which is used as a protein in animal feed.
